分享

linux crontab 配置定时mapreduce job

lzw 发表于 2013-12-28 16:41:01 [显示全部楼层] 回帖奖励 阅读模式 关闭右栏 0 9871
本帖最后由 pig2 于 2014-8-21 11:54 编辑
配置执行job shell,shell文件:exec_mr.sh
  1. /home/hadoop/hadoop-1.0.4/bin/hadoop jar  /home/hadoop/dedup.jar /home/hadoop/input/* /home/hadoop/output/*
复制代码


配置crontab命令,mapreduce job 每天晚上01:00执行一次,配置文件:crontab_mr。


  1. 0 1 * * * bash /home/hadoop/exec_mr.sh
复制代码


添加使用crontab命令添加执行hadoop用户job
  1. [hadoop@hadoop ~]$ sudo crontab -u hadoop /home/hadoop/crontab_mr
复制代码


重启crontab
  1. [hadoop@hadoop ~]$ sudo /sbin/service crond restart
复制代码

欢迎加入about云群9037177932227315139327136 ,云计算爱好者群,亦可关注about云腾讯认证空间||关注本站微信

没找到任何评论,期待你打破沉寂

您需要登录后才可以回帖 登录 | 立即注册

本版积分规则

关闭

推荐上一条 /2 下一条